We categorize your unique romantic needs into 4 distinct "Endgame" archetypes. Here is a preview of who you might be destined for:
This is the partner who offers stable attachment. They are consistent, reliable, and emotionally available. Think: domestic bliss, safety, and a love that feels like a warm blanket.
For the sapiosexuals. This result points to a partner who stimulates your mind. They will debate you, push you to grow, and view the relationship as a meeting of the minds. Think: witty banter and power couple goals.
The archetype for those who fear boredom. This partner is the agent of chaos (in a good way). They bring adventure, spontaneity, and passion. Think: late-night road trips and breaking the rules.
The stoic protector. This partner speaks the language of Acts of Service. They may be quiet, but their loyalty is absolute. Think: silent support and "I’ll handle it" energy.
